Market Overview and Report CoverageThe InP OMVPE Epitaxial Wafers Market refers to the market for Indium Phosphide (InP) wafers that are produced using the Organometallic Vapor Phase Epitaxy (OMVPE) method. These wafers are used in various applications such as optoelectronics, telecommunications, and photovoltaics.
The market for InP OMVPE epitaxial wafers is expected to grow at a steady pace, with a projected Compound Annual Growth Rate (CAGR) of 5.90% during the forecasted period. This growth can be attributed to the increasing demand for high-performance semiconductor materials in industries such as telecommunications and information technology. Additionally, the growing focus on renewable energy sources like solar power is expected to drive the demand for InP wafers in photovoltaic applications.

InP OMVPE epitaxial wafers are available in various market types based on the diameter of the wafer, including 2 inches, 3 inches, 4 inches, and 6 inches. The different market types cater to various applications and requirements in the semiconductor industry. The 2 inches and 3 inches wafers are commonly used for research and development purposes, while the 4 inches and 6 inches wafers are more widely used for high-volume production and commercial applications, providing a range of options for customers with different needs.

InP OMVPE epitaxial wafers find applications in various industries such as LED, optoelectronic devices, communication industrial, and others. In the LED industry, these wafers are used for producing high-performance and energy-efficient lighting solutions. Optoelectronic devices benefit from the superior electronic properties of these wafers for applications like photodetectors and solar cells. The communication industry utilizes InP wafers for developing high-speed data transmission components.
